Exploring Specific Chakras

The human body is home to seven chakras, each with unique functions. Understanding these centers can help you focus your meditation practice more effectively.

The Sacral Chakra

The sacral chakra (also known as the second chakra) is located in the lower abdomen and governs emotional stability, creativity, and sexuality. Blockages in this chakra can lead to emotional disturbances, addiction, and instability. Balancing this chakra through meditation can help address these issues.

The Heart Chakra

The heart chakra (also known as the fourth chakra) is the center of love, compassion, and emotional healing. Located in the center of the chest, it plays a crucial role in mental health. By focusing on this chakra, you can cultivate a state of inner calm and emotional well-being.
